on a number line, what is x-4<-3?

Respuesta :

jimthompson5910 jimthompson5910
  • 03-12-2019

Add 4 to both sides

x - 4 < -3

x-4+4 < -3+4

x < 1

To graph this on a number line, plot an open circle at 1 on the number line. Do not fill in the open circle. Shade to the left of the open circle. The shaded region represents all x values smaller than 1.

The graph is shown below.
